Output 9721061a138829c87b80ddf5e19fceb2a8d1a42c28d5335c8e30eda958e109b8:13

value
183536
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6276a9ae910abb200931693ebc17536572d7640b OP_EQUALVERIFY OP_CHECKSIG
address
19ydNdvhHZvdXzmMLY8AkrixvWMYwrwPcv
transaction
9721061a138829c87b80ddf5e19fceb2a8d1a42c28d5335c8e30eda958e109b8
spent
true